Edge Esmeralda 2026A series of experiential salons bridging inner, relational, cultural, and planetary flourishing through cross-disciplinary dialogue across 8 frontier clusters.
The Agora Series convenes interdisciplinary human flourishing salons at Apollo Innovation Commons—experiential gatherings that bridge conversations across four dimensions of flourishing: inner, relational, cultural, and planetary. Named for the ancient public square where ideas, commerce, and civic life intersected, the Agora Series treats dialogue itself as a generative practice. Each salon draws together practitioners and researchers spanning AI, biotech, robotics, climate, arts, and human flourishing: to explore questions no single discipline can answer alone. Rather than panels or lectures, salons are designed as embodied, participatory experiences: structured dialogue, contemplative practice, and shared inquiry that move participants from abstract exchange toward felt understanding. The series rests on a simple premise: the frontier challenges of our time, technological, ecological, and social, are inseparable from questions of how humans and communities flourish. By placing scientists, builders, artists, and contemplatives in sustained conversation, the Agora Series cultivates the cross-pollination that breakthrough work requires, while modeling a form of civic discourse rooted in care, curiosity, and rigor. Outcomes include a recurring convening rhythm, a growing network of cross-lab collaborators, and a documented body of insights that informs Apollo's wider research and community programming.
